What Makes a Vacuum Suitable for Matted Carpet?

The best vacuum for matted carpet should possess specific features to effectively clean dense fibers and restore the carpet’s appearance.

  • Strong Suction Power: A vacuum with strong suction is crucial for matted carpets as it can lift dirt, debris, and matted fibers more effectively. This feature ensures that the vacuum can penetrate deep into the carpet pile where dirt accumulates, providing a thorough clean.
  • Adjustable Height Settings: Vacuums with adjustable height settings allow users to tailor the cleaning head to the carpet’s thickness. This ensures optimal contact with the carpet fibers, avoiding damage while maximizing cleaning efficiency.
  • Brush Roll or Beater Bar: A vacuum equipped with a brush roll or beater bar can help to separate matted fibers, allowing for better dirt removal. These components agitate the carpet, helping to lift dirt and restore the carpet’s original texture.
  • Powerful Filtration System: A vacuum with a quality filtration system, such as HEPA filters, can trap allergens and dust particles effectively. This is particularly beneficial for households with allergies, as it helps maintain better indoor air quality while cleaning matted carpets.
  • Weight and Maneuverability: A lightweight and maneuverable vacuum makes it easier to clean large areas of matted carpet without causing fatigue. This is especially important for users who need to navigate around furniture or reach tight spaces.
  • Large Capacity Dustbin: A vacuum with a larger dustbin reduces the frequency of emptying, making it more convenient for cleaning sessions. This is particularly useful when tackling matted carpets, as they tend to collect more dirt and debris.
  • Attachments and Tools: Specialized attachments, such as upholstery brushes and crevice tools, enhance the vacuum’s versatility for cleaning various surfaces and hard-to-reach areas. These tools can help maintain the carpet’s condition by ensuring all areas are addressed.
  • Durability and Warranty: Investing in a durable vacuum with a good warranty can provide peace of mind, ensuring the vacuum will withstand the rigors of regular cleaning on matted carpets. A reliable model will perform consistently over time, making it a worthwhile investment.

How Does Brush Roll Technology Impact Cleaning Efficiency?

Brush roll technology significantly impacts cleaning efficiency, especially for matted carpets.

  • Agitation: Brush rolls provide a mechanical action that helps to lift dirt and debris from deep within carpet fibers.
  • Versatility: Many brush rolls are adjustable or removable, allowing vacuums to adapt to different carpet types and surface conditions.
  • Filtration: Brush rolls often work in tandem with advanced filtration systems to ensure that dust and allergens are effectively captured during the cleaning process.
  • Durability: Quality brush rolls are designed to withstand wear and tear, ensuring long-term effectiveness for heavy-duty cleaning tasks.

Agitation: The primary function of a brush roll is to provide agitation, which is essential for loosening dirt and pet hair that become embedded in matted carpets. This mechanical action allows the vacuum to extract more debris compared to suction alone, making it vital for maintaining cleanliness in high-traffic areas.

Versatility: Many modern vacuums come with adjustable brush rolls that can be set to different heights, allowing them to effectively clean various carpet pile heights and even hard flooring. This adaptability enables users to switch between cleaning tasks without needing multiple machines, making it a convenient feature for households with diverse cleaning needs.

Filtration: Brush rolls often work alongside advanced filtration systems, such as HEPA filters, to trap fine particles and allergens as dirt is agitated and lifted from carpets. This combination not only enhances cleaning efficiency but also contributes to a healthier indoor environment by reducing airborne irritants.

Durability: High-quality brush rolls are constructed from resilient materials that can endure frequent use, ensuring long-lasting performance. This durability is particularly important for users who have matted carpets, as these areas require more robust cleaning tools to maintain their appearance and hygiene over time.

What Types of Vacuums are Most Effective for Matted Carpet?

The best vacuums for matted carpet are those designed to penetrate deep into the fibers and effectively lift dirt and debris.

  • Upright Vacuums: Upright vacuums are powerful and typically come with adjustable height settings, making them ideal for matted carpets. They often feature strong suction and rotating brushes that can help fluff up the carpet fibers while removing embedded dirt.
  • Canister Vacuums: Canister vacuums offer versatility with their long hoses and attachments, allowing you to reach corners and edges easily. They tend to be lighter than upright models and can be more maneuverable, making them effective for cleaning larger areas of matted carpet without straining your back.
  • Pet Hair Vacuums: Specifically designed for pet owners, these vacuums feature specialized attachments and stronger suction to tackle pet hair that often contributes to matting. They usually have tangle-free brush rolls and filters that trap allergens, making them a great choice for homes with pets.
  • Robotic Vacuums: While not as powerful as traditional vacuums, robotic vacuums can help maintain clean matted carpets by regularly picking up surface dirt and debris. Many models come with smart navigation systems and can be programmed to clean at specific times, providing a convenient cleaning solution.
  • Shampoo Vacuums: Shampoo vacuums or carpet cleaners are designed for deep cleaning and can rejuvenate matted carpets by using water and cleaning solutions to lift stains and dirt. They can be particularly effective for restoring the appearance of heavily soiled carpets and are beneficial for periodic deep cleaning.
